Table of ContentsReviewsFear Is Just a Word . . . offers a voice to the victims of drug violence without demonizing the perpetrators. As a longtime observer of Mexico's drug wars I would place this book alongside the emotionally involving and sophisticated works of chroniclers like Marcela Turati, Sandra Rodríguez Nieto and the Sinaloa-based journalist Javier Valdez Cárdenas, murdered by gunmen in 2017. A harrowing account of one family's struggle, it reads both as a thriller and as a moving work of reportage * Times Literary Supplement * Author InformationAzam Ahmed is a Global Investigative Correspondent for the New York Times. He is the former Bureau Chief in Mexico, and previously was the New York Times Bureau Chief in Afghanistan. Tab Content 6Author Website:Countries AvailableAll regions |
